  We have a great 6-7 month season where Juvi's to 40-50lbs are

  almost always present.  Hit Google earth and look for the Sebastian River on 
the east coast of Florida.   Both the north and south forks hold these fish for 
months. 

   

  The rod of choice is a 7 or 8 wt with dark clousers. I have a great

  picture of me fighting one of these fish on an 8'8"  7wt Scott Heliply. It 
was my screen saver for a long time.  (I was going to send it to you, but I 
cannot find it.   Where do old screen savers go to die ??

   

  Unless we are chasing the 100+ lb'rs on the beaches on either coast, or the 
real Giants in Homosassa or the keys, the biggest rod is generally a 10wt.
